Obituary: Martha Celine Borders Beckers, 91, Lebanon
Martha Celine Borders Beckers, 91, of Lebanon, died Sunday, March 2, 2014, at the VA Hospital in Louisville. She was born Nov. 5, 1922, in Lebanon. She was a veteran of the U.S. Coast Guard, a retired cafeteria manager of St. Augustine School and was a member of St. Augustine Catholic Church.
She was preceded in death by her husband, Gilbert Joseph “Joe” Beckers (1993); her parents, Roy Thomas and Leonora Elder Borders; one sister, Barbara Borders Durham; and three brothers, Roy Borders Sr., Joe Borders and Hughes Borders.
Survivors include two sons, Vallen P. Beckers of Louisville and Gilbert Lynn Beckers of Lebanon; two sisters, Cecilia Thomas and Emily Coyle, both of Lebanon; four brothers, Arnold Borders of Hopkinsville, Harry Borders of Georgetown, James Borders of Albuquerque and Terry Borders of Indianapolis; five grandchildren; and two great-grandchildren.
A Mass of Christian Burial is 11 a.m. Friday, March 7, 2014, at St. Augustine Catholic Church with burial in the Lebanon National Cemetery.
Visitations is after 4 p.m. Thursday, March 6, 2014, at Bosley Funeral Home in Lebanon. A prayer service is 7 p.m. Thursday with Deacon Dennis May.
Bosley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.
